January 11, 2021, 12:54:08 AM

A plausible scenario? Check both values and timing.

https://dailyhodl.com/2021/01/09/macro-guru-raoul-pal-says-coinbase-ipo-will-suck-institutional-liquidity-from-bitcoin/

roughly ~100K local peak in Feb or so, back to about 40-45K in the summer, up above 200K in the late fall.

BAKKT is being SPACed as well at $2bil (not that much).
https://www.bloomberg.com/news/articles/2021-01-08/crypto-exchange-bakkt-said-near-merger-with-victory-park-spac

Honestly, I am surprised that Coinbase wants to IPO instead of choosing the SPAC move.
They could have gotten some cash (a bil or more) without much dilution.



I think coinbase IPO will be less interesting for people/institutions that want to actually own bitcoin , or invest in it with bigger timeframes in mind.
This way, they (CB) mainly just maximise profits, at an amount of risk that even bitcoin doesn't inherently carry.
When bitcoin goes down, coinbase is history.
When coinbase goes down, king daddy doesn't give a fuck  Cool

Well, that's the exact opposite of what he is saying, but it remains to be seen.
His point is that for fiat holders it is easier to invest in a company vs bitcoin itself. MSTR is just a very small vessel in market cap, but Coinbase would be a bigger one.
Think of this a a flow of funds. If some funds flow would be converted/re-directed to CB in lieu of bitcoin, bitcoin price might temporarily stagnate or even decline somewhat.
That's the gist of his argument, but he could be wrong, of course.
